A study of the anodic oxidation of titanium at low voltages ( < 50 V)
in aqueous and non-aqueous electrolytes was carried out in order to ob
tain thin films with dielectric properties. The reaction led, in both
cases, to a microcrystalline structure of anastase (TiO2) with a diele
ctric constant of approximately 40 and with capacitance values of the
system Ti/TiO2/electrolyte between 10 and 13.9 muF V/cm2. The remainin
g dielectric parameters of the films obtained in the non-aqueous solut
ion suggest its possible use as a base in electrolyte capacitors.
